A small tool to view real-world ActivityPub objects as JSON! Enter a URL
or username from Mastodon or a similar service below, and we'll send a
request with
the right
Accept
header
to the server to view the underlying object.
{
"@context": [
"https://www.w3.org/ns/activitystreams",
{
"ostatus": "http://ostatus.org#",
"atomUri": "ostatus:atomUri",
"inReplyToAtomUri": "ostatus:inReplyToAtomUri",
"conversation": "ostatus:conversation",
"sensitive": "as:sensitive",
"toot": "http://joinmastodon.org/ns#",
"votersCount": "toot:votersCount"
}
],
"id": "https://23.social/users/thomasfricke/statuses/113788292846492965",
"type": "Note",
"summary": null,
"inReplyTo": null,
"published": "2025-01-07T17:39:18Z",
"url": "https://23.social/@thomasfricke/113788292846492965",
"attributedTo": "https://23.social/users/thomasfricke",
"to": [
"https://www.w3.org/ns/activitystreams#Public"
],
"cc": [
"https://23.social/users/thomasfricke/followers"
],
"sensitive": false,
"atomUri": "https://23.social/users/thomasfricke/statuses/113788292846492965",
"inReplyToAtomUri": null,
"conversation": "tag:23.social,2025-01-07:objectId=10623849:objectType=Conversation",
"content": "<p>If you want to read <a href=\"https://example.com/something\" target=\"_blank\" rel=\"nofollow noopener noreferrer\" translate=\"no\"><span class=\"invisible\">https://</span><span class=\"\">example.com/something</span><span class=\"invisible\"></span></a> and it is paywalled, most of the pages can be accessed by adding archive.is skipping the annoying captcha.</p><p>Manually change the url to <a href=\"https://archive.is/example.com/something\" target=\"_blank\" rel=\"nofollow noopener noreferrer\" translate=\"no\"><span class=\"invisible\">https://</span><span class=\"ellipsis\">archive.is/example.com/somethi</span><span class=\"invisible\">ng</span></a></p><p>In my browser (Brave) I have added archive.is as a search engine.<br />Shortcut :a<br />Url string <a href=\"https://archive.is/%s\" target=\"_blank\" rel=\"nofollow noopener noreferrer\" translate=\"no\"><span class=\"invisible\">https://</span><span class=\"\">archive.is/%s</span><span class=\"invisible\"></span></a></p><p>If you use a service regularly, please pay the fee if it has a value for you!</p>",
"contentMap": {
"en": "<p>If you want to read <a href=\"https://example.com/something\" target=\"_blank\" rel=\"nofollow noopener noreferrer\" translate=\"no\"><span class=\"invisible\">https://</span><span class=\"\">example.com/something</span><span class=\"invisible\"></span></a> and it is paywalled, most of the pages can be accessed by adding archive.is skipping the annoying captcha.</p><p>Manually change the url to <a href=\"https://archive.is/example.com/something\" target=\"_blank\" rel=\"nofollow noopener noreferrer\" translate=\"no\"><span class=\"invisible\">https://</span><span class=\"ellipsis\">archive.is/example.com/somethi</span><span class=\"invisible\">ng</span></a></p><p>In my browser (Brave) I have added archive.is as a search engine.<br />Shortcut :a<br />Url string <a href=\"https://archive.is/%s\" target=\"_blank\" rel=\"nofollow noopener noreferrer\" translate=\"no\"><span class=\"invisible\">https://</span><span class=\"\">archive.is/%s</span><span class=\"invisible\"></span></a></p><p>If you use a service regularly, please pay the fee if it has a value for you!</p>"
},
"attachment": [],
"tag": [],
"replies": {
"id": "https://23.social/users/thomasfricke/statuses/113788292846492965/replies",
"type": "Collection",
"first": {
"type": "CollectionPage",
"next": "https://23.social/users/thomasfricke/statuses/113788292846492965/replies?only_other_accounts=true&page=true",
"partOf": "https://23.social/users/thomasfricke/statuses/113788292846492965/replies",
"items": []
}
},
"likes": {
"id": "https://23.social/users/thomasfricke/statuses/113788292846492965/likes",
"type": "Collection",
"totalItems": 9
},
"shares": {
"id": "https://23.social/users/thomasfricke/statuses/113788292846492965/shares",
"type": "Collection",
"totalItems": 3
}
}